Sales & Support: +1 (480) 360-6463
Live Demo Get Started

TypeScript Developer Job Description Template

Saturday, November 27th, 2021

TypeScript Developer Job Description Template

Do you believe it’s difficult to hire TypeScript developers? Yes? We are here to assist you! You’ll be well on your way to recruiting a new team member if you use VIVAHR’s FREE TypeScript Developer Job Description Template. It’s critical to have the right team on your side when it comes to candidate search. For your advancement, the outputs should be speedier and more efficient.

VIVAHR software is our plan for making the recruiting process more enjoyable for you. Follow our tips for finding candidates and adjust your credentials to each role. This way, you’ll have a higher chance of finding the proper person for the position.

What is a TypeScript Developer?

TypeScript developers are in charge of ensuring that users have the greatest possible experience with the company’s apps and platforms. It is critical to establish a clear and exact TypeScript Developer job description in order to attract the TypeScript Developer who best fits your demands.

Related Job Titles for TypeScript Developer

The Top TypeScript Developer Skills

Skill

Why it’s important

Communication

One of the most important abilities that any developer should possess is one that you might not consider at first. You would believe that developers will spend their days glued to their computers, seldom conversing with other people. Developers, on the other hand, will need to know how to communicate effectively with everyone from their own clients to their supervisors. Furthermore, if you'll be working with a group of engineers, team communication and teamwork will be critical to your success.

HTML & CSS

Frameworks like Angular do not obviate the need for a thorough grasp of the most fundamental web development technologies. Although Angular offers the building blocks for creating fast, functional apps, those apps must still be displayed in a browser, which necessitates the usage of HTML and CSS to create user interfaces. Angular Material and other style libraries are wonderful for fast delivering attractive apps, but you'll need to know how and where to change things to get the exact appearance you want.

RxJS

RxJS is a reactive programming library for observable streams. It exists outside of Angular, however, it is included with the framework and is used for a variety of functions, including data requests over HTTP. Observables and other RxJS capabilities are used by Angular to offer a uniform API for conducting asynchronous operations.

Empathy

Empathy for other programmers is also necessary. It's not simple to work as a developer. It's challenging to stay up with the constantly changing tools and technology. Keep in mind that the developers on your team each brought a unique set of talents and experiences to the table. Examine this and consider how you might learn from each other and complement one other to develop amazing software.

TypeScript

Another skill you should acquire is TypeScript. It allows you to write React code that is more statically typed, allowing you to specify data types as you go. Furthermore, as a result, your code becomes significantly more durable, trustworthy, transparent, and simple to comprehend. Many businesses look for this skill in a coder.

TypeScript Developer Job Description Template (Free)

To join our front-end development team, we’re searching for a professional TypeScript Developer. You’ll be responsible for creating and implementing user interface components utilizing React.js ideas and processes like Redux, Flux, and Webpack in this position. You’ll be in charge of front-end performance profiling and enhancement, as well as documenting our codebase.

You should have in-depth knowledge of JavaScript and React ideas, outstanding front-end development abilities, and a thorough grasp of progressive web apps to succeed as a TypeScript Developer. Finally, a top-tier TypeScript Developer should be able to design and construct modern user interface components to enhance the user experience.

TypeScript Developer Duties & Responsibilities:

  • Plan, develop and implement the user interface approach.
  • Collaborate with designers and developers to create modern, user-friendly interfaces for our online sites.
  • Work on our online sites’ design, appearance, and feel.
  • Enhance the user experience on a regular basis.
  • User preferences should be investigated.
  • Investigate innovative technology and industry best practices.
  • Work in a collaborative setting with shared code.
  • Conduct code analysis and recommend policy and practice improvements to improve the quality of JS and CSS.

TypeScript Developer Requirements:

  • It is necessary to have a bachelor’s degree in computer science, information technology, or a similar field.
  • Previous expertise as a React.js developer is required.
  • Expertise with JavaScript, CSS, HTML, and other front-end languages.
  • Knowledge of React.js, Webpack, Enzyme, Redux, and Flux.
  • User interface design experience is a plus.
  • Mocha and Jest knowledge.
  • Browser-based debugging and performance testing software experience.
  • Excellent problem-solving abilities.
  • Excellent project management abilities.
Joshua F.
Redline Electric & Solar

"The best recruiting platform on the market! VIVAHR allowed us to create a dashboard and applicant experience like no other!!"

Get more applicants from the Best Job Boards

Post for free to 50+ job boards
Unlimited Job Postings
Unlimited Applicants

Sample Interview Questions For TypeScript Developer

Once you’ve gathered all of the applications that have been submitted, you may use these sample interview questions for TypeScript Developer. These may assist you in narrowing down your options and selecting the best-qualified individual for the position.

Personal 

  1. Could you describe yourself in one word?
  2. What are your impressions about our firm?
  3. What drew your attention to this position?

Human Resources

  1. What would your previous employer say about you?
  2. Can you tell me about a moment when you had to deal with a disagreement at work?
  3. Do you like to work in a team?

Management

  1. What is your management style?
  2. How well are you at prioritizing your work?
  3. Do you know how to manage multiple projects?

Technical Skills and Knowledge

  1. What kinds of programming apps have you worked with before?
  1. Do you have any other programming languages under your belt?
  2. What talents do you think you’ll need for this job?

 

What are the Educational Requirements For a TypeScript Developer?

Some TypeScript devs have a Computer Science degree, but it’s not mandatory for this position. Besides official education, knowledge of Angular.js, React.js can always come in handy. Also, there are numerous TypeScript courses available to attend.

How Much To Pay a TypeScript Developer When Hiring

TypeScript developers usually earn from $59,119 to $209,551 annually, and their median yearly salary is around $141,171. The hourly wages range from $30 to $101, and the median hourly pay is $68.

Percentile

10%

25%

50% (Median)

75%

90%

Hourly Wage

$30

$57

$68

$81

$101

Annual Wage

$59,119

$118,238

$141,171

$168,577

$209,551

Frequently asked questions about TypeScript Developer

 

What is the difference between TypeScript and React.js?

TypeScript is a “typed superset of JavaScript that compiles to ordinary JavaScript,” while React is a “JavaScript framework for designing user interfaces.” We effectively use a typed version of JavaScript to construct our UIs by combining them.

What is the role of a TypeScript developer? 

TypeScript developers are in charge of ensuring that users have the greatest possible experience with the company’s apps and platforms. It is critical to establish a clear and exact TypeScript Developer job description in order to attract the TypeScript Developer who best fits your demands.

What may TypeScript be used for? 

JavaScript code is simplified using TypeScript, making it easier to understand and debug. TypeScript is a free and open-source programming language. For JavaScript IDEs and techniques like static checking, TypeScript provides extremely productive development tools. TypeScript simplifies the reading and understanding of code.

Similar Job Descriptions as TypeScript Developer

Stay up to date

Sign up for VIVAHR's weekly email for hiring essentials.